How do you get scabies? Causes, prevention, and treatment
WebScabies (pronounced skay-bees) is caused by scabies mites — tiny, insect-like parasites that infect the top layer of your skin. Scabies causes rashes, irritation, and a ton of itching. It’s easily spread to other people during skin-to-skin touching. Scabies mites burrow underneath the top layer of your skin and lay eggs.
